This simple yet flavorful recipe for Balsamic Carrots transforms these vibrant orange roots into a sweet and tangy side dish. With just a handful of ingredients and minimal preparation, you can create a delightful addition to your meal in no time.

Prep Time: 5 mins

Total Time: 10 mins

Serves 2

 

INGREDIENTS:

Before we embark on this culinary journey, let’s gather all the ingredients you’ll need to make these delicious Balsamic Carrots:

  • 1 cup carrots, peeled and chopped (or 1 cup baby carrots)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il (or clarified butter)
  • 1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ar
  • 1 pinch of salt
  • 1 pinch of black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on honey
  • 1/4 lemon, juice of
  • 1 pinch of cinnamon

 

INSTRUCTIONS:

Let’s dive into the step-by-step process of making these delectable Balsamic Carrots:

  1. Prep the Carrots: Begin by preparing the carrots. You can either peel and chop regular carrots or use convenient baby carrots. Place the carrots in a microwave-safe bowl and add 1 tablespoon of water. This little bit of moisture helps steam the carrots. Microwave the bowl for approximately 6 minutes, or until the carrots are tender. This method allows you to achieve perfectly cooked carrots quickly.
  2. Whisk the Flavorful Dressing: While the carrots are cooking in the microwave, grab a large shallow bowl. In this bowl, you’ll create a flavorful dressing for your carrots. Whisk together the following ingredients: olive oil (or clarified butter), balsamic vinegar, a pinch of salt, a pinch of black pepper, honey, the juice of 1/4 lemon, and a pinch of cinnamon. The combination of these ingredients will infuse your carrots with a delightful blend of sweet, tangy, and aromatic flavors.
  3. Combine and Stir: Once the carrots are tender, carefully remove them from the microwave. Be cautious, as the bowl will be hot. Transfer the hot, steamed carrots directly into the bowl with your prepared dressing. Stir the carrots thoroughly, ensuring they are evenly coated with the balsamic mixture. The heat from the carrots will help meld the flavors together.
